Resumen
This document develops a technical, economic and environmental feasibility study of the transition to a photovoltaic solar energy source, applied to the lighting of the warehouses located in the industrial area of Melobo in the town of Fontibón, and finally the results are socialized with one of the stakeholders in the area. Manufacturing activities, waste disposal, chemical and logistic processes, among other industrial and commercial activities are carried out in these warehouses. Therefore, they require to be illuminated during the whole working day, which implies a considerable expenditure of electrical energy. In the first part, a description of the area of influence is developed, making use of public access sources, relevant data is collected on the companies in the area, such as the company name, economic activity and size; data on the solar radiation that reaches the area on a daily basis is also referenced. With the data collected on radiation, and making use of applications for measuring surfaces, legislation on recommended levels of lighting in work environments and taking as a reference a common model of luminaire for industrial environments, a diagnosis ofthe electrical energy consumption of the warehouses is made. With the data on the area of influence and the diagnosis of the use of electrical energy, the materials, supplies and labor necessary for the installation and annual maintenance of a photovoltaic solar energy system that completely supplies the energy consumption for the lighting of all the warehouses are defined, as well as the cost of the initial investment of the system and its annual maintenance expenses; In the same chapter the potential savings are defined taking into account the current electricity tariffs of the company providing the service and finally the requirements to access the tax benefits stipulated in the Colombian legislation for investors in renewable energy sources are described and taking into account the savings for 17 electricity service in the electricity bill, the costs and expenses of the implementation, a time inwhich the reversion of the investment would occur is stipulated. Finally, using emission factors provided by national institutions, a figure is established to mitigate the emission of carbon dioxide gas into the atmosphere through conventional energy sources; in addition to this, relevant information is provided regarding the production of solar modules and the environmental impact they may cause. The results and the methodology applied were made known to one of the stakeholders of the company that has more impact in terms of size and electricity consumption, through a socialization and a booklet exposing the above points along with a conclusion and recommendations.
